Tablets

Like candles, tablets are divided into groups according to their effects. Only a urologist should prescribe medication for you after an exam that specifies how to treat prostate adenoma. Buying and taking medication without a prescription is unlikely to have a beneficial effect on a speedy recovery. What drugs for prostatitis are more often prescribed by doctors:

  • Anti-inflammatory - are prescribed in the acute form of the adenoma for painful urination. These drugs help cure prostatitis quickly and prevent the disease from moving into a chronic stage.
  • Antispasmodics - This group of tablets relieves cramps and relaxes muscles, which greatly improves blood circulation.
  • Antibiotics - if the prostate adenoma is caused by an infectious lesion of the gland and bacteria that cause the disease are found, then tablets of this group are prescribed. Only the examining doctor can determine which antibiotic for prostatitis is right for you. Antibiotics are taken along with rectal drugs in one course.

Instillations

The instillation method is one of the options for getting rid of the disease, which is based on the introduction of a drug for the treatment of prostate adenoma and prostatitis into the affected area. This method of treatment is prescribed to completely remove from the urinary tract the bacteria that contribute to the progression of prostate inflammation. As a medicine, Cycloferon liniment, antiseptics and ozonated solutions are used.

The instillation procedure should only be performed in the treatment room with a doctor. Only he can choose the right solution, insert the high quality catheter into the urethra and make all the necessary manipulations to keep the solution inside. Depending on the stage of the disease, instillation 2-4 times a week can take 1 to 3 months.
